
"I think it's time to finish the mission... we've made, obviously, tremendous progress as measured by the number of targets hit and all the rest of it, and Iranian losses have been truly staggering!"
"The tricky part gets to be is when the mission, the military piece of it, the early piece of it is accomplished. What next?"
"Did anybody ever imagine when we'd hit 10,000 targets or whatever it is, that there'd still be more to do? It shows you how utterly militarized the country of Iran has been."
Brit Hume emphasized the need for President Trump to continue military operations in Iran, arguing that the mission is not yet complete. He referenced Senator John Kennedy's belief that objectives in Iran have been achieved, but countered that significant progress has been made and Iranian losses are substantial. Hume compared the situation to past conflicts, noting that while initial military objectives were often met quickly, the subsequent challenges are more complex. He highlighted the ongoing threat posed by Iran and the necessity of further military action.
